Average Food Batchmakers Salary in Northeast Maine nonmetropolitan area

The average salary for a Food Batchmakers in Northeast Maine nonmetropolitan area is $42,460. This compensation is in line with national standards, reflecting a balanced and stable local job market.

Executive Summary

  • Average Salary: $42,460 per year.
  • Growth Trend: Salaries have shifted 5.8% over the last 5 years.
  • Top Earners: Senior professionals (90th percentile) earn up to $59,940.
  • Outlook: The current demand for Food Batchmakerss is stable, with a local workforce of approximately 30 professionals. This role remains a specialized component of the broader Northeast Maine nonmetropolitan area economy.

Food Batchmakers Salary Distribution in Northeast Maine nonmetropolitan area

The earning potential for Food Batchmakerss in Northeast Maine nonmetropolitan area varies significantly by experience level. The salary gap is relatively narrow, suggesting consistent and predictable earnings from entry-level to senior positions. Entry-level roles (10th percentile) typically start around $30,550, while highly experienced professionals can command wages upwards of $59,940.

Methodology: Salary data is derived from the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) OEWS 2024 release. Figures represent gross pay before taxes. Analysis includes 30 employees in the Northeast Maine nonmetropolitan area area with a job density of 0.489 per 1,000 jobs. Cost of Living data is estimated based on state and metro averages.
